背景:
- シナプス伝播は,膀のエクソサイトーシスとエンドサイトーシスを含む.
- エンドサイトーシスによる膜回収は,膀のリサイクルに不可欠です.
- エクソサイトーシスはカルシウム依存性であることが知られている.
研究 の 目的:
- 細胞内カルシウム濃度 ([Ca2+]i) がシナプス胞内細胞を調節する役割を調査する.
- カルシウムがエクソサイトーシス後の膜回収率に影響するかどうかを判断する.
主な方法:
- 網膜双極性ニューロンのシナプス端末の容量測定.
- 細胞内カルシウムのレベルを操作して,内細胞症への影響を評価する.
主要な成果:
- エンドოციトーシスは,上昇した[Ca2+]iによって有意に抑制された.
- 膜回収の速度は[Ca2+]i (ヒル係数4) に大きく依存していた.
- [Ca2+]i >= 900 nMでエンドサイトーシスが完全に廃止されました.
結論:
- 細胞内カルシウムは,内細胞症のネガティブなフィードバックの調節剤として作用する.
- このカルシウム媒介のフィードバックは,神経伝達物質の分泌後の膜の回復を制御する.
- このメカニズムは,膀のリサイクルに影響することによって,活動に依存したシナプス抑うつに寄与する可能性があります.

Long-term Depression
Long-term depression, or LTD, is one of the ways by which synaptic plasticity—changes in the strength of chemical synapses—can occur in the brain. LTD is the process of synaptic weakening that occurs over time between pre and postsynaptic neuronal connections. The synaptic weakening of LTD works in opposition to synaptic strengthening by long-term potentiation (LTP) and together are the main mechanisms that underlie learning and memory.
Fusion of Secretory Vesicles with the Plasma Membrane
Proteins and neurotransmitters in secretory vesicles can be released from a cell upon vesicle docking, priming, and fusion with the plasma membrane. Vesicles are docked and primed in preparation for the quick exocytosis of their contents in response to a stimulus. The fusion process is mainly carried out by a SNAP Receptor or SNARE complex, consisting of synaptobrevin, syntaxin-1, and SNAP-25.

Chemical Synapses
Chemical synapses are specialized sites between two neurons or between a neuron and a non-neuronal cell like a muscle, glandular or sensory cell.
Because chemical synapses depend on the release of neurotransmitter molecules from synaptic vesicles to pass on their signal, there is an approximately one millisecond delay between when the axon potential reaches the presynaptic terminal and when the neurotransmitter leads to opening of postsynaptic ion channels. Feedback Regulation of Calcium Concentration
Calcium is an essential signaling molecule required for various cellular functions. Calcium pumps and ion channels on cell and organellar membranes, such as those on the endoplasmic reticulum (ER), regulate calcium concentrations inside the cell. They remain closed, keeping the cytosolic calcium levels low at a resting state.
